数据可视化平台如何支持跨平台访问?

在当今信息化时代,数据已成为企业、政府、科研机构等各个领域的重要资产。如何有效地管理和利用这些数据,成为了一个亟待解决的问题。数据可视化平台作为一种新兴的技术手段,可以帮助用户直观地理解和分析数据。然而,如何支持跨平台访问,成为了一个关键问题。本文将深入探讨数据可视化平台如何支持跨平台访问,以帮助用户随时随地获取数据信息。

一、跨平台访问的意义

跨平台访问指的是用户可以通过不同的设备、操作系统和浏览器访问同一数据可视化平台。这一功能具有以下重要意义:

  1. 提高用户体验:用户可以根据自己的需求和喜好,选择最合适的设备进行数据可视化操作,从而提高用户体验。
  2. 降低使用门槛:不同设备和操作系统的用户都可以轻松访问数据可视化平台,降低了使用门槛。
  3. 提高数据利用率:跨平台访问使得数据可视化平台的应用范围更广,有助于提高数据利用率。

二、数据可视化平台支持跨平台访问的途径

  1. 响应式设计

响应式设计是指根据不同设备和屏幕尺寸自动调整页面布局和内容。数据可视化平台采用响应式设计,可以确保用户在各类设备上都能获得良好的访问体验。


  1. HTML5技术

HTML5是当前最流行的网页制作技术,具有跨平台、兼容性好等特点。数据可视化平台采用HTML5技术,可以确保在各类浏览器和设备上正常显示。


  1. Web API

Web API是一种用于在网页和服务器之间进行数据交互的技术。数据可视化平台可以通过Web API实现数据获取、处理和展示,从而支持跨平台访问。


  1. 移动端适配

数据可视化平台可以通过移动端适配技术,使应用在手机、平板等移动设备上正常运行。这包括对页面布局、字体大小、交互方式等方面的优化。


  1. 跨平台开发框架

跨平台开发框架如Flutter、React Native等,可以帮助开发者构建跨平台应用。数据可视化平台可以利用这些框架,降低开发成本,提高开发效率。

三、案例分析

  1. ECharts:ECharts是一款基于HTML5的图表库,具有丰富的图表类型和良好的跨平台性能。用户可以通过浏览器访问ECharts网站,实现数据可视化。

  2. D3.js:D3.js是一款基于JavaScript的数据可视化库,具有高度的可定制性和跨平台性能。用户可以通过Web API或服务器端渲染技术,实现跨平台访问。

  3. Tableau:Tableau是一款商业化的数据可视化平台,支持多种设备访问。用户可以通过Tableau Web或Tableau Mobile访问平台,实现数据可视化。

四、总结

数据可视化平台支持跨平台访问,是提高用户体验、降低使用门槛、提高数据利用率的重要途径。通过响应式设计、HTML5技术、Web API、移动端适配和跨平台开发框架等途径,数据可视化平台可以实现跨平台访问。在实际应用中,ECharts、D3.js、Tableau等平台已经取得了良好的效果。随着技术的不断发展,相信数据可视化平台在跨平台访问方面将会更加完善。

猜你喜欢:OpenTelemetry